首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将三个表连接到一个连接表中

是一种常见的数据库操作,用于解决多对多关系的数据存储和查询问题。连接表也被称为关联表或中间表。

在关系型数据库中,多对多关系无法直接表示,因此需要通过连接表来建立关联。连接表通常包含两个外键,分别指向要连接的两个表的主键。通过连接表,可以实现多个表之间的关联查询。

连接表的优势在于:

  1. 灵活性:连接表可以处理多对多关系,使数据模型更加灵活。
  2. 数据一致性:通过连接表,可以确保数据的一致性,避免冗余和重复数据。
  3. 查询效率:连接表可以通过索引优化查询,提高查询效率。

连接表的应用场景包括:

  1. 用户和角色关系:一个用户可以拥有多个角色,一个角色也可以被多个用户拥有。
  2. 商品和订单关系:一个商品可以被多个订单购买,一个订单也可以包含多个商品。
  3. 学生和课程关系:一个学生可以选择多门课程,一门课程也可以有多个学生选修。

在腾讯云的数据库产品中,可以使用云数据库MySQL、云数据库MariaDB、云数据库PostgreSQL等来创建和管理连接表。这些产品提供了丰富的功能和工具,支持高可用、备份恢复、性能优化等需求。

腾讯云数据库MySQL产品介绍:https://cloud.tencent.com/product/cdb_mysql

腾讯云数据库MariaDB产品介绍:https://cloud.tencent.com/product/cdb_mariadb

腾讯云数据库PostgreSQL产品介绍:https://cloud.tencent.com/product/cdb_postgresql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

14分30秒

Percona pt-archiver重构版--大表数据归档工具

4分29秒

MySQL命令行监控工具 - mysqlstat 介绍

1分38秒

腾讯千帆河洛场景连接-维格表&表格AI智能识别并归档 教程

47秒

KeyShot特效

7分14秒

Go 语言读写 Excel 文档

1.2K
1分40秒

秸秆禁烧烟火识别系统

2分7秒

使用NineData管理和修改ClickHouse数据库

7分20秒

鸿怡电子工程师:芯片测试座在半导体测试行业中的关键角色和先进应用解析

1分38秒

河道水面漂浮物识别检测

2分5秒

AI行为识别视频监控系统

3分8秒

智能振弦传感器参数智能识别技术:简化工作流程,提高工作效率的利器

1分16秒

振弦式渗压计的安装方式及注意事项

领券